Transportation to Airport from Beirut City Center

Beirut Rafic Hariri Intl. Airport

Beirut, the capital and largest city of Lebanon, offers limited but comfortable transportation facilities between the city center and the airport, as well as the historical and natural beauties it has. You can be at the airport in a very short time with taxis or private cars that you can easily find in the city center.

Taxi

Since there is no official transportation vehicle to the Beirut Rafic Hariri International Airport, which is the only civil airport in the country since 1954 and was established for the replacement of the much smaller Bir Hassan Airfield, taxis become compulsory for passengers. Taxis are also open for bargaining for the average amount you will pay for the travel of about 15 minutes. In the city where taxi drivers speak French and English, taxis are air-conditioned and comfortable.

Private Vehicle

It is also a good option to go to the airport from the city center by private vehicle. Because in Beirut having a population of 1.5 million, it is extremely normal to encounter a traffic like in Istanbul. There are many alternatives but 2 major roads directly connect the city to the airport. The first one is the road that is connected to the airport via Ahmad Mukhtar Beyhum and Hafez Al-Assad street.

The second one is the road arriving at the airport through the Gamal Abdel Nasser Street, Ruhollah Khomeini Street and Umar ibn Al-Khattab Street. By using the either road, you can arrive at the airport within 15 minutes and can leave your vehicle to the parking lot with a capacity of 2350 vehicles.

Airport Information

The airport, which hosts 6 million passengers per year, aims to host 35 million passengers annually as a result of the developments in the process up to 2035. It also offers free internet service for airport passengers. The only airport of Lebanon, the country having the most non-Muslim population in the Middle East, has places of worship for every religion.

There are a few cafes and restaurants as well as a Japanese restaurant right now at the terminals. The terminals are expected to have more facilities when they are expanded and new terminals are opened in the future.

The airport, which welcome millions of mainly European tourists as well as Lebanese living abroad, has a very interesting Beirut Duty Free. There is also a car gallery in Beirut Duty Free.

Transportation to Hamburg City Center from Airport

Hamburg Airport

The transportation from Hamburg International Airport, which is 8 km away from Hamburg city center, is provided by taxis, buses and suburban trains. If you wish, you can easily reach the city center by renting a car at the airport.

Train

This is the most preferred transportation alternative. Hamburg Airport is connected to the city with S-bahn, S1 Suburban railway network. It takes 30 minutes to reach the city by using this line. Trains depart every 10 minutes. You can get on the train line S1 from the airport, get off at Ohlsdorf station, take the line U1 and reach the city center.

Bus

Another option that you can use on this route is bus. Hamburg has a developed public transportation system. Buses usually depart every hour. The buses called "Nachtbus" offer service at nights. To get to the city from the airport, you need to take the bus route 606.

Taxi

Taxi is also among the ideal options for traveling to the city center. Taxis can be preferred especially if you are not familiar with the city or if you have heavy luggage. You can reach your destination in about 30 minutes by taking a taxi from the airport. The taxi fare that you will pay will be around 35 Euro.

Car Rental

Hamburg Airport is one of the busiest airports of the world. By renting a car at the airport, you can comfortable travel to your destination. You can rent your car from companies such as Enterprise, Alamo, National, Global Drive and start discovering the city in a comfortable way.
